Scott City 4, Woodland 1

Brett Dirnberger had a triple and a double among his three hits as the Rams won on the road on Monday.

Ryan Brock recorded the win on the mound for Scott City (8-5). He struck out one, walked two and allowed three hits.

Ben McCormick struck out 10 over 6 2/3 innings and took the loss for the Cardinals (10-10). He walked three, hit three batters and allowed six hits.

Dirnberger broke a 1-1 tie in the seventh inning with a two-out triple. Dirnberger also scored on the play, crossing home on a throwing error.

The Hawks repeated as champion of their own nine-team Kelly Invitational with a four-stroke victory at the Cape Girardeau Jaycee Municipal Golf Course.

Kelly, led by Derrick Garner's third-place 79, finished with a 367 total. Doniphan and Clearwater both finished at 371.

Kennett's Aaron Beck was the medalist with a 7-over-par 77, finishing one stroke ahead of Advance's Brian Whitson.
